This free publication is a companion guide to the main passage guide for this region: 'Passage Planning Guide - Great Barrier Reef and Torres Strait (PPG - GBRTS 2023-24 Edition)'.

The PDF contains waypoints, tabulated passage information and charts for these routes.

This publication contains passage notes on the following routes:

  • South of Cairns
  • Whitsunday Passage
  • Hydrographers Passage.

However, where further details on the Reef, the relevant authorities, pilotage, tides, ballast water, MARPOL and routes North of Cairns to Torres Strait are required, you must in all cases refer to: 'Passage Planning Guide - Great Barrier Reef and Torres Strait (PPG - GBRTS 2023-24 Edition)'.
